Home
last modified time | relevance | path

Searched refs:workload_mask (Results 1 – 11 of 11) sorted by relevance

/openbmc/linux/drivers/gpu/drm/amd/pm/powerplay/
H A Damd_powerplay.c945 hwmgr->workload_mask &= ~(1 << hwmgr->workload_prority[type]); in pp_dpm_switch_power_profile()
946 index = fls(hwmgr->workload_mask); in pp_dpm_switch_power_profile()
950 hwmgr->workload_mask |= (1 << hwmgr->workload_prority[type]); in pp_dpm_switch_power_profile()
951 index = fls(hwmgr->workload_mask); in pp_dpm_switch_power_profile()
/openbmc/linux/drivers/gpu/drm/amd/pm/powerplay/hwmgr/
H A Dpp_psm.c298 index = fls(hwmgr->workload_mask); in psm_adjust_power_state_dynamic()
H A Dvega12_hwmgr.h387 uint32_t workload_mask; member
H A Dvega20_hwmgr.h515 uint32_t workload_mask; member
H A Dvega12_hwmgr.c407 data->workload_mask = 0xff; in vega12_hwmgr_backend_init()
H A Dvega20_hwmgr.c445 hwmgr->workload_mask = 1 << hwmgr->workload_prority[PP_SMC_POWER_PROFILE_BOOTUP_DEFAULT]; in vega20_hwmgr_backend_init()
H A Dvega10_hwmgr.c840 hwmgr->workload_mask = 1 << hwmgr->workload_prority[PP_SMC_POWER_PROFILE_BOOTUP_DEFAULT]; in vega10_hwmgr_backend_init()
H A Dsmu7_hwmgr.c1859 hwmgr->workload_mask = 1 << hwmgr->workload_prority[PP_SMC_POWER_PROFILE_FULLSCREEN3D]; in smu7_init_dpm_defaults()
/openbmc/linux/drivers/gpu/drm/amd/pm/swsmu/
H A Damdgpu_smu.c1125 smu->workload_mask = 1 << smu->workload_prority[PP_SMC_POWER_PROFILE_BOOTUP_DEFAULT]; in smu_sw_init()
1889 index = fls(smu->workload_mask); in smu_adjust_power_state_dynamic()
1956 smu->workload_mask &= ~(1 << smu->workload_prority[type]); in smu_switch_power_profile()
1957 index = fls(smu->workload_mask); in smu_switch_power_profile()
1961 smu->workload_mask |= (1 << smu->workload_prority[type]); in smu_switch_power_profile()
1962 index = fls(smu->workload_mask); in smu_switch_power_profile()
/openbmc/linux/drivers/gpu/drm/amd/pm/swsmu/inc/
H A Damdgpu_smu.h516 uint32_t workload_mask; member
/openbmc/linux/drivers/gpu/drm/amd/pm/powerplay/inc/
H A Dhwmgr.h806 uint32_t workload_mask; member